IMG-20210523-WA0093.jpgJack fruits
Jack fruit is the most common fruit in my state kerala and there are more than 20 types of jack fruits. varikka and koozha are the 2 common types found in kerala, and i have these 2 types in my food forest.

20210610_115047.jpgmiracle fruit
This fruit really is a miracle of nature. Many of you have seen this or heard about this fruit. Its a shrub plant. You can even plant these in pots. After eating this fruit,if you eat any sour food items. It will not be sour instead it will be sweet. For eg if you eat miracle fruit and after that if you eat lime, it will be too sweet not sour.

20210531_161631.jpgcoco fruit
Everyone know that choclate is made from the seeds of coco fruit. Here in Idukki most of the people have coco trees in their land. The seeds inside are covered with a fleshy layer and its too sweet.. These seeds are then separated and people will sell it in the market. These seeds are then dryed and processed to make choclate in the chocolate factories.
